Proverb

Kagutuĩ ka mũciĩ, gatihakagwo ageni.

Translation

The oilskin of the home is not for applying on strangers.

Comment

The traditional proverb suggests that home affairs should remain secret and should not be revealed to strangers as this is tantamount to washing dirty linen in public.
